Suresh Kumar, M and Sujata, M and Madan, M and Venkataswamy, MA and Bhaumik, SK (2006) Failure analysis of compressor rotor blade of an aeroengine. Project Report. National Aerospace Laboratories, Bangalore.
Full text not available from this repository. (Request a copy)Abstract
Fractographic study suggests that the locking slot of the blade has failed by fatigue. The fatigue was of low cycle-high stress type. Examination revealed that fatigue was stress related and was caused due to severe deformation of the material in contact with the locking ring. The reason for such deformation at the locking slot needs to be determined. The microstructure of the blade material was found satisfactory and there were no metallurgical abnormalities
